Output 6b6768e13efaabad24c8e74c8a7dea90f69e37621356044942e53e9ee2a7c088:0

value
478928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e4346cac87534990c86f4138b766a465a48cc4c OP_EQUAL
address
3DCdfAoKnLD8uppc4EEo5Boyq7i6Zwvie7
transaction
6b6768e13efaabad24c8e74c8a7dea90f69e37621356044942e53e9ee2a7c088
spent
true